How Do Fire Watch Guards Support Regulatory Compliance?
Fire codes and safety regulations often require a fire watch when protection systems are out of service. Non-compliance can result in fines, shutdowns, or legal liability. Data shows that compliance failures increase financial exposure and insurance complications. Professional fire watch guards maintain detailed logs, patrol reports, and incident documentation, helping property owners demonstrate compliance and avoid regulatory penalties during system outages.
What Role Does Documentation Play During Fire System Outages?
Accurate documentation is essential for accountability and compliance. Studies indicate that proper record-keeping reduces disputes and improves safety audits. Fire watch guards document patrol times, observations, hazards identified, and corrective actions taken. These records provide a clear safety trail, supporting inspections and demonstrating proactive risk management.
